> > +static int ceu_s_input(struct file *file, void *priv, unsigned int i)
> > +{
> > + struct ceu_device *ceudev = video_drvdata(file);
> > + struct ceu_subdev *ceu_sd_old;
> > + int ret;
> > +
>
> Add a check:
>
> if (i == ceudev->sd_index)
> return 0;
>
> I.e. if the new input == the old input, then that's fine regardless of the
> streaming state.

On a side note this is the kind of checks that the core should handle, but
that's out of scope for this patch.

> > + if (vb2_is_streaming(&ceudev->vb2_vq))
> > + return -EBUSY;
> > +
> > + if (i >= ceudev->num_sd)
> > + return -EINVAL;
>
> Move this up as the first test.
>
> > +
> > + ceu_sd_old = ceudev->sd;
> > + ceudev->sd = &ceudev->subdevs[i];
> > +
> > + /* Make sure we can generate output image formats. */
> > + ret = ceu_init_formats(ceudev);
> > + if (ret) {
> > + ceudev->sd = ceu_sd_old;
> > + return -EINVAL;
> > + }
> > +
> > + /* now that we're sure we can use the sensor, power off the old one. */
> > + v4l2_subdev_call(ceu_sd_old->v4l2_sd, core, s_power, 0);
> > + v4l2_subdev_call(ceudev->sd->v4l2_sd, core, s_power, 1);
> > +
> > + ceudev->sd_index = i;
> > +
> > + return 0;
> > +}

[snip]

> > +
> > +static int ceu_notify_complete(struct v4l2_async_notifier *notifier)
> > +{
> > + struct v4l2_device *v4l2_dev = notifier->v4l2_dev;
> > + struct ceu_device *ceudev = v4l2_to_ceu(v4l2_dev);
> > + struct video_device *vdev = &ceudev->vdev;
> > + struct vb2_queue *q = &ceudev->vb2_vq;
> > + struct v4l2_subdev *v4l2_sd;
> > + int ret;
> > +
> > + /* Initialize vb2 queue. */
> > + q->type = V4L2_BUF_TYPE_VIDEO_CAPTURE_MPLANE;
> > + q->io_modes = VB2_MMAP | VB2_USERPTR | VB2_DMABUF;
>
> Don't include VB2_USERPTR. It shouldn't be used with dma_contig.
>
> You also added a read() fop (vb2_fop_read), so either add VB2_READ here
> or remove the read fop.

Agreed. I'd drop both VB2_USERPTR and vb2_fop_read().
